Attributes 29,462% Revenue Growth to proprietary software engineered by Founder and AI Innovation
LPT Aperture Holdings, the parent company of LPT Realty, Aperture Global Real Estate, and Listing Power Tools, today announced it has been ranked No. 2 overall on the 2025 Deloitte Technology Fast 500™, a prestigious list recognizing the fastest-growing technology, media, telecommunications, life sciences, fintech, and energy tech companies in North America. LPT Aperture Holdings achieved an extraordinary 29,462% revenue growth over the three-year period evaluated.
Robert Palmer, Founder and CEO of LPT Aperture Holdings, credits the company’s explosive growth to founder-engineered proprietary software, leadership at the forefront of artificial intelligence innovation and an industry ready for disruption.
Palmer wrote the original code for Listing Power Tools at his kitchen table, creating the foundation for an AI-driven marketing platform that transformed real estate. As the sole shareholder, he built LPT Aperture without outside investors, maintaining full ownership and creative control as it grew into one of North America’s fastest-growing companies, reaching a current revenue run rate of around $700 million with operations across the U.S. and abroad.

Under Palmer’s leadership, LPT Aperture Holdings has evolved into a technology and real estate enterprise that is redefining how property transactions are powered, scaled, and experienced. The launch of LPT Realty marked the fastest brokerage expansion in industry history. In 2025, the company introduced Aperture Global, a new luxury brand designed to change how exceptional properties are marketed and sold around the world.
The 2025 Deloitte Technology Fast 500™ companies achieved revenue growth ranging from 122% to 29,738%, with an average growth rate of 1,079%. LPT Aperture Holdings’ second-place ranking places it among an elite group of innovators driving transformation across the North American economy.
About the 2025 Deloitte Technology Fast 500™
In order to be eligible for Technology Fast 500 recognition, companies must own proprietary intellectual property or proprietary technology that significantly contributes to the company’s operating revenues. Companies must have base-year operating revenues of at least US $50,000, and current-year operating revenues of at least US$5 million, with a growth rate of 50% or greater. Additionally, companies must be headquartered within North America (United States and Canada).
Now in its 31st year, the Deloitte Technology Fast 500 provides a ranking of the fastest-growing technology, media, telecommunications, life sciences, fintech, and energy tech companies — both public and private — in North America. This year’s Technology Fast 500 award winners are selected based on percentage fiscal year revenue growth from 2021 to 2024.
